How they compare
Middle East, North Africa, Afghanistan & Pakistan (excluding high income) currently reports 16.12 million number against 1.48 million number in Morocco, a difference of 14.63 million number.
That makes Middle East, North Africa, Afghanistan & Pakistan (excluding high income)'s figure about 10.9 times Morocco's.
Across all 50 years both countries report, Middle East, North Africa, Afghanistan & Pakistan (excluding high income) has been ahead every year.
Middle East, North Africa, Afghanistan & Pakistan (excluding high income) ranks 34th and Morocco ranks 36th of 45 groups.
Middle East, North Africa, Afghanistan & Pakistan (excluding high income) has averaged higher in every one of the 5 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Middle East, North Africa, Afghanistan & Pakistan (excluding high income) | Morocco |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1970s | 6.66 million number | 734,955 number | 5.92 million number | Middle East, North Africa, Afghanistan & Pakistan (excluding high income) |
| 1980s | 9.13 million number | 1.14 million number | 7.99 million number | Middle East, North Africa, Afghanistan & Pakistan (excluding high income) |
| 1990s | 12.36 million number | 1.30 million number | 11.06 million number | Middle East, North Africa, Afghanistan & Pakistan (excluding high income) |
| 2000s | 16.62 million number | 1.53 million number | 15.09 million number | Middle East, North Africa, Afghanistan & Pakistan (excluding high income) |
| 2010s | 16.86 million number | 1.54 million number | 15.32 million number | Middle East, North Africa, Afghanistan & Pakistan (excluding high income) |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Male population of the age-group theoretically corresponding to tertiary education as indicated by theoretical entrance age and duration.
